When Caroline Kennedy married Edwin Schlossberg on July 19, 1986, in Centerville, Massachusetts, the family tried to maintain the affair personal, but a crowd of 2,000 individuals gathered outdoors the church. Those who noticed the bride and groom stroll down the church steps caught a glimpse of Caroline in her white silk organza marriage ceremony dress. Designed by Carolina Herrera, the costume had a spherical neck, short sleeves and an extended bodice embroidered with white shamrocks (a nod to her father's Irish ancestry). The full skirt extended right into a sweeping 25-foot prepare, and on her head she wore a bow with a long tulle veil.
